2015-10-18 87 views
0

我有这段代码,它无法在响应模式下工作。我的意思是按钮会出现,但是当我点击按钮时,我的导航栏不会出现。我不知道这是什么。 css和js文件也被添加到文档中,但它仍然不起作用。这个问题的任何提示将不胜感激。引导程序导航无法在响应模式下工作

<!DOCTYPE html> 
<html> 
<head> 

<meta charset="UTF-8"> 

<!-- ------------------------------bootstrap css link--------------------- --> 
<link rel="stylesheet" type="text/css" href="css/bootstrap.css"> 
<link rel="stylesheet" type="text/css" href="css/bootstrap-theme.css"> 
<link rel="stylesheet" type="text/css" href="css/custom-css.css"> 

</head> 
<body> 



    <div class="row"> 
     <div class="col-md-12 top-site"> 

       <div class="top-bg col-md-12"> 
       </div> 

       <!-- <div class="col-md-2 social"> 


       </div> 
       <div class="col-md-2 search"> 

       </div> --> 

       <div class="row"> 
        <nav class="navbar navbar-default" role="navigation"> 
         <div class="navbar-header"> 
          <button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#collapse"> 
           <span class="sr-only">Toggle navigation</span> 
           <span class="icon-bar"></span> 
           <span class="icon-bar"></span> 
           <span class="icon-bar"></span> 
          </button> 
         </div> 
         <div class="collapse navbar-collapse" id="collapse"> 
          <ul class="nav navbar-nav"> 
           <li><a href="">خانه</a></li> 
           <li><a href="">تماس با ما</a></li> 
           <li><a href="">لینک به ما</a></li> 
           <li><a href="">درباره ما</a></li> 
           <li><a href="">تبلیغات در سایت</a></li> 
          </ul> 
         </div> 
        </nav> 
       </div> 


     </div> 
    </div> 

<div class="container"> 
    <div class="row"> 
    </div> 

</div> 



<!-- ------------------------------bootstrap css link--------------------- --> 
<script type="text/javascript" src="bootstrap.js"></script> 
<script type="text/javascript" src="npm.js"></script> 
<script type="text/javascript" src="jquery-2.1.0.min.js"></script> 

</body> 
</html> 

回答

1

jQuery库应包括以前引导。

<script type="text/javascript" src="jquery-2.1.0.min.js"></script> 
<script type="text/javascript" src="bootstrap.js"></script> 
+0

谢谢你。是工作。请问为什么它有这样的效果? –

+0

@ sajjad.rezaee bootstrap需要jQuery才能正常工作。如果你没有用正确的顺序导入,boostrap不能看到jQuery方法。 –

+0

是的,我看到,但为什么它不能看到jquery时,我引入jquery后导入其他jquery? –